What is XPS? Technical Infrastructure and Areas of Use

XPS (XML Paper Specification) is a file format developed by Microsoft and was first introduced with Windows Vista. XPS provides a platform-independent way to view document content, layout, and fonts while preserving them. Created with an XML-based structure, XPS offers functionality similar to the PDF format. XPS documents are often used for printing because printers support this format. Since XPS files can contain both text and graphics, they can be used to store a wide variety of documents.

Among the advantages of the XPS format are high image quality and portability, while its disadvantages include limited compatibility and lack of support in some software.

Advantages of the PS Format and Its Common Use

PS (PostScript) is a page description language developed by Adobe. This format is used to ensure that document content is processed correctly by printers and other devices. The PS format is widely used, especially in the graphic design and printing industry. High-quality print outputs are provided while allowing the use of complex graphics and texts together. Additionally, PS files are compatible with Adobe Illustrator and other design software.
